What skills and experience we're looking for
This is an exciting opportunity to join a new special school, part of the Unity Schools Partnership multi-academy trust, which opened in September 2020.
At this exciting time for the school, we are looking for individuals with a passion for SEN to join our team and make an impact on the learning of our students. The successful applicant will need to be able to work flexibly, have excellent behaviour management skills and be prepared to assist pupils on a one to one basis as well as in small groups and whole class settings.
Sir Bobby Robson School educates young people between the ages of 8-16 who have a wide range of social, emotional and mental health needs. Many of the pupils will also be on the Autistic Spectrum. The school serves a catchment area that covers Ipswich and surrounding areas of Suffolk.
What the school offers its staff
The school will be part of a collaborative, forward thinking Academy Trust of 32 schools.The school will also be adding to our network of special schools, alongside The Bridge School, Ipswich, Sir Peter Hall School, Bury St Edmunds and Churchill Special School, Haverhill. In addition to this, we have been approved to open a new special school in Romford. You will be supported in your role by experienced special education leaders who will be available to offer and advice and guidance as the school moves forward under your leadership.
